About GAIL (India) Limited
GAIL (India) Limited is India’s leading natural gas company and one of the country’s largest Public Sector Undertakings (PSUs).
Established in 1984, the company plays a vital role in transporting natural gas across India through its extensive pipeline network.
Over the years, GAIL has diversified into several energy businesses including:
- Natural Gas Transmission
- Natural Gas Marketing
- LPG Transmission
- Petrochemicals
- Liquid Hydrocarbons
- City Gas Distribution
- Renewable Energy
- LNG Trading
As India moves towards cleaner fuels and higher natural gas consumption,
GAIL is expected to remain one of the biggest beneficiaries of the country’s long-term energy transition.
GAIL Q1 FY27 Results Overview
GAIL announced its financial results for the quarter ended
30 June 2026 (Q1 FY2026-27).
The company delivered a sharp sequential improvement in revenue,
operating profit,
and net profit,
supported mainly by better transmission performance and stronger liquid hydrocarbon operations.
The official press release states that transmission and liquid hydrocarbons remained resilient during the quarter, while gas marketing and polymer volumes were affected by geopolitical headwinds. :contentReference[oaicite:0]{index=0}
| Particulars | Q1 FY27 | Q4 FY26 |
|---|---|---|
| Revenue from Operations | ₹38,982 Crore | ₹34,797 Crore |
| EBITDA | ₹6,948 Crore | ₹2,175 Crore |
| Profit Before Tax | ₹5,773 Crore | ₹1,577 Crore |
| Profit After Tax | ₹4,292 Crore | ₹1,262 Crore |
| Quarterly Capex | ₹6,176 Crore | — |

Key Operational Highlights
| Business Segment | Q1 FY27 | Q4 FY26 | Trend |
|---|---|---|---|
| Natural Gas Transmission | 122.36 MMSCMD | 118.99 MMSCMD | Positive |
| Gas Marketing | 93.82 MMSCMD | 101.88 MMSCMD | Declined |
| Liquid Hydrocarbon Production | 232 TMT | 194 TMT | Positive |
| Polymer Production | 51 TMT | 153 TMT | Declined |
| LPG Transmission | 1,077 TMT | 1,114 TMT | Stable |
Natural Gas Transmission continued to improve during the quarter,
highlighting the strength of GAIL’s pipeline infrastructure.
Meanwhile,
Gas Marketing and Polymer businesses faced pressure due to external geopolitical disruptions,
which affected overall demand and volumes. These operational figures are taken from the company’s official Q1 FY27 press release.

Capital Expenditure Indicates Long-Term Confidence
Growth companies continue investing even during uncertain market conditions.
GAIL spent
₹6,176 crore
during Q1 FY27 as part of its long-term expansion strategy,
against an annual planned capex of approximately
₹11,500 crore. Such investments are expected to strengthen pipeline connectivity,
expand gas infrastructure,
support future demand,
and improve earnings potential over the next several years.

1. GAIL Included in FTSE4Good Index Series
One of the biggest achievements for GAIL during July 2026 was its inclusion in the
FTSE4Good Index Series.
The FTSE4Good Index recognises companies demonstrating strong Environmental,
Social and Governance (ESG) standards.
Being included in this global ESG index improves GAIL’s visibility among
international institutional investors who specifically invest in responsible businesses.
StockRadiance Insight
ESG-focused funds are growing rapidly worldwide.
Inclusion in global ESG indices can improve foreign institutional participation
over the long term and strengthen investor confidence.
2. Gas-Based Fertilizer Project in Maharashtra
GAIL recently signed an MoU with
Rashtriya Chemicals & Fertilizers (RCF)
to establish a gas-based fertilizer project in Maharashtra.
This project has the potential to increase domestic gas consumption,
expand industrial demand,
and improve long-term transmission volumes for GAIL.
As India’s fertilizer sector shifts towards cleaner fuels,
such projects can become an important growth driver over the coming decade.
Dividend History
One of GAIL’s biggest attractions for long-term investors is its consistent dividend-paying record.
Being a Maharatna PSU,
the company has regularly rewarded shareholders through interim dividends and final dividends.
| Year | Corporate Action |
|---|---|
| 2026 | Interim Dividend ₹5 per Share |
| 2025 | Final Dividend ₹1 per Share |
| 2025 | Interim Dividend ₹6.50 per Share |
| 2024 | Interim Dividend ₹5.50 per Share |
| 2023 | Interim Dividend ₹4 per Share |
Regular dividend payments make GAIL attractive for investors seeking a combination
of capital appreciation and dividend income.
Bonus Share History
| Year | Bonus Ratio |
|---|---|
| 2022 | 1:2 Bonus Issue |
The company rewarded shareholders with a
1:2 Bonus Issue
during 2022,
demonstrating management’s confidence in future business growth.
